MANILA, Philippines —  Rapper Loonie and his four other cohorts were reportedly arrested during a buy-bust operation in a hotel in Makati on Wednesday night. 

Officers of Makati Police Station’s Drug Enforcement Unit identified the four other suspects as David Rizon, Ivan Agustin, Albert Alvarez and Idyll Liza Peroramas, Loonie's younger sister.

According to Makati police chief Senior Superintendent Rogelio Simon, the transaction happened at the basement of a hotel located along Polaris Street in Barangay Poblacion, Makati City at 8:45 p.m. 

The FlipTop emcee and his companions were reportedly caught with 15 sachets of high-grade marijuana worth P100,000.

Loonie, whose real name is Marlon Peroramas, is also behind the songs “Tao Lang” and “Pilosopo,” among others.
